A customer reported to me, that if he download the iCal of an Event, that the Event will be in Outlook 2 hours earlier (i.e. instead 10:00 its 8:00)
Joomlas System time zone is set to "Zurich"
If I change the System time to "UTC" than the ical and the time on the event is the same (8:00 is 8:00).
But, the time is still 2 hours to early. If I edit the event, the start time shows 10:00, which is right, but in the event overview its, 8:00!
It seems that there are two kind of time sources.
